“In reality, energy has to do with our entire wellbeing. So our emotional self, our mental self, our spiritual self, and our physical self. And we can't look at energy just as physical. So if you look at it not just as physical, where are you being drained or leaking energy when it comes to your emotions? So I explain this to people, like consider where you are really low vibe at times. Like what brings you to that level? What brings you to a level of guilt and shame and jealousy and envy and those kinds of things? You know, and some people might say, it's social media or they might say like, it's my mom or like, you know, a certain friend or whatever. And it's like, okay, well take stock of that because you need to understand when you're leaking energy. It's like putting on your oxygen mask before, you know, helping the person next to you.” (11:25 in this cast)
Erin Coupe is a human development expert, keynote speaker, and author of I Can Fit That In who helps high achievers break free from the productivity trap and reclaim their energy.
In this conversation, we dive deep into the invisible energy leaks that are draining your life force every single day without you even realizing it. She started questioning why we believe we have to grind until 65 before we're allowed to actually live our lives. She works with Fortune 500 companies while openly discussing consciousness, energy, and what it actually means to steward your life force.

Ideas that really stuck out to me:
Your daily glass of wine is an energy leak disguised as self-care. When Erin was in corporate, she'd pour wine at 5:30pm every day thinking she was unwinding. After years of inner work, she realized it was actually an escape from her own mind. When you need something every single day to take the edge off, you're not relaxing, you're avoiding. And that avoidance is costing you more energy than you realize.
Resentment is a flashing warning light that your energy is hemorrhaging somewhere. Erin felt resentment toward motherhood, her husband, colleagues, and clients. It was unconscious patterns bleeding energy into her conscious world.
Busyness is the socially acceptable energy vampire. Broadcasting how busy and needed you are isn't impressive — it's broadcasting that you've abandoned yourself. When you have no time in your calendar for yourself you're not succeeding but instead you're drowning.
Every compulsive behavior is an energy leak you can't see. Pulling out your phone in an elevator, scrolling when bored, and running to the bathroom when conversations lull. These aren't random actions but rather they're your system trying to soothe discomfort. And that constant soothing is exhausting you at a level you don't consciously register.
Energy leadership is about holistic stewardship across four dimensions. The emotional, mental, spiritual, and physical. Most people only think about physical energy but you're leaking energy emotionally through low-vibe relationships, mentally through negative thought loops, and spiritually through disconnection from purpose. Understanding these dimensions is like finally seeing where all your money has been going after months of wondering why you're broke.
Low-vibe relationships drain you at the subconscious level. Some people leave you feeling depleted every single time. You might not consciously register it but your energy system does. Erin recently discovered family members had unfollowed her on Instagram. Her first reaction was to question if she was hurt then she realized they were actually draining her field, and their removal was a gift not a rejection.
Your thoughts and beliefs are software that needs updating. Just like you eagerly update your phone when prompted, you need to actively update the programming in your mind. The limiting beliefs running in the background of your consciousness won't disappear on their own. You have to consciously identify what no longer serves you and replace it with what does.
Shadow material you're avoiding is actively draining your battery. The parts of yourself you're trying to shine or shove down don't disappear. They sit in your subconscious requiring constant energy to keep suppressed. What you resist persists, and that resistance is exhausting. When Erin was writing her book, she had ugly crying sessions confronting childhood material she didn't want to face. But that was her healing journey, and once she stopped suppressing it, she got that energy back.
The biggest energy leak is fighting against reality. Erin works more hours now than in her corporate job but it doesn't drain her because she's not fighting it. Every moment you resist what is you're burning fuel. When you're present with what you're doing and you've consciously chosen your path rather than feeling obligated to it, the quality of the experience fundamentally transforms.
Mindless scrolling on social media, overworking to tell our minds that we are busy, drinking wine to unwind, avoiding silence and some little things we do everyday aren't random. They're your consciousness trying to soothe discomfort.
Once you start seeing these patterns you can work with them. Not by white-knuckling and forcing yourself to stop but by addressing what's underneath.
That's when real change happens.
